Oh man - I agree totally - I am a runner and i train aerobics - I had Nikes and I usually wear size 39 (for shoes)- that's 8 US I think - and the size totally fits me. The problem was I felt when I trained like my feet were in a box, it didn't feel tight, but my feet felt sort of tired. So.. for the next ones I decided to buy one size bigger (40 European, 8.5 US) - and let me tell you - they feel much more comfortable and no more tired feet!!! So, my recommendation to all athletes is to buy one size bigger running shoes than hey wear usually.
